Asphalt shingle market 2025 global analysis, share and forecast

In recent years, stakeholders have continued to invest in the asphalt shingle market because manufacturers prefer these products because of their low cost, affordability, ease of installation and reliability. Emerging construction activities mainly in the residential and non-residential sectors have had a positive impact on the industry’s prospects.
It is worth noting that recycled asphalt has become an important selling point, and suppliers hope to profit from the many advantages of asphalt shingle roofing. Recycled shingles are used for pothole repair, asphalt pavement, practical cutting of bridges, cold repair of new roofs, driveways, parking lots and bridges, etc.
In the context of the surge in demand in the residential and commercial sectors, reroofing applications are expected to account for the largest share of the asphalt shingle market. The damage and wear caused by hurricanes and other natural disasters show the importance of asphalt shingles. In addition, it is said that reroofing derails the growth of microorganisms and fungi and can withstand the effects of ultraviolet rays, rain and snow. Despite this, in 2018, residential reroofing applications exceeded $4.5 billion.
Although high-performance laminates and three-piece boards will continue to attract investors, the trend of size boards is aimed at increasing the market revenue of asphalt boards in the subsequent period. Dimensional shingles, also known as laminated shingles or construction shingles, can properly protect against moisture and decorate the aesthetic value of the roof.
The durability and ease of use of size shingles prove that they have become the first choice for high-end housings. Indeed, the revenue share of North American size bituminous ribbon tile roofing materials in 2018 exceeded 65%.
Residential building applications will become the main source of income for asphalt shingle manufacturers. Some advantages such as low cost, high performance and beautiful roof materials have been confirmed. Due to the type of residence, the volume share of asphalt shingles exceeds 85%. The environmental protection characteristics of asphalt after scrapping make asphalt roof shingles popular among end users.
The North American bituminous shingle market may dominate the industry landscape, as the region is expected to see increasing demand for reroofing and advanced products such as dimensional shingles and high-performance laminated shingles. Industry insiders hint that bad weather and increasing construction activities have played a role in promoting the demand for asphalt shingles in the area. The market share of North American asphalt shingles is fixed at over 80%, and the region is likely to dominate in the next five years.
The unprecedented construction activities in residential and commercial spaces in emerging economies such as India and China have triggered demand for asphalt shingle roofs in the Asia-Pacific region. The traction of asphalt shingles in China, South Korea, Thailand and India has increased substantially, reflecting the projected growth rate of asphalt shingles in the Asia-Pacific region to exceed 8.5% by 2025.
The asphalt shingle market shows a commercial structure, and companies such as GAF, Owens Corning, TAMKO, certain Teed Corporation and IKO seem to control a large market share. Therefore, the asphalt shingle market is highly integrated with leading companies in the United States. At the same time, it is expected that stakeholders will launch innovative products based on advanced technology to enter Asia Pacific and Eastern Europe.
